Director, State Public Health Laboratories
WA State Dept of Health
The Public Health Laboratories – Where Science Protects Communities At the Public Health Laboratories, every test matters. From hunting emerging pathogens to ensuring every newborn in the state gets life‑saving screenings, your work will drive disease detection, outbreak response, and protect Washington’s most vulnerable. We’re the state’s reference lab, tracking rare threats like rabies, hantavirus, and West Nile virus, analyzing outbreaks, and safeguarding food and water safety. Here, science meets service in a collaborative, equity‑driven team committed to real‑world impact and public health at scale. The Opportunity: As the Director of State Public Health Laboratories, you will provide executive, scientific, and operational leadership for Washington’s multi‑disciplinary Public Health Laboratories (PHL). You will oversee more than 250 employees and laboratory programs spanning public health microbiology, environmental laboratory sciences, newborn screening, quality assurance, safety, operations, and central services. You will set strategic direction, lead senior laboratory leaders, and ensure the PHL has the workforce, systems, resources, and scientific capabilities needed to deliver reliable laboratory services. This role is accountable for the overall administration and performance of the PHL, including laboratory quality and accreditation, regulatory compliance, workforce and organizational development, financial stewardship, laboratory modernization, emergency preparedness, and implementation of new testing methods and technologies. You will oversee a biennial operating budget of approximately $66 million and help guide significant investments in laboratory infrastructure, equipment, information systems, and scientific capabilities. As Washington's senior public health laboratory leader, you will also serve as a scientific advisor and represent the PHL with Tribal Nations, local health jurisdictions, health care and laboratory partners, and state and federal agencies. Your leadership helps ensure Washington has a strong, coordinated laboratory system capable of detecting disease, supporting newborn screening and environmental health programs, informing outbreak investigations, and responding to biological, chemical, and other public health emergencies. Minimum Qualifications: There are multiple pathways to qualify for this position. You must meet the federal qualification requirements for a Laboratory Director of a laboratory performing high-complexity testing under 42 CFR § 493.1443 through one of the following options and any additional criteria listed. Please ensure any relevant experience defined below is outlined in your cover letter, resume, and/or applicant profile. Option 1 – Board-Certified Pathologist: MD or DO, licensed to practice in the state where the laboratory is located, and certified in anatomic pathology, clinical pathology, or both by the American Board of Pathology or American Osteopathic Board of Pathology. Option 2 – Physician/Podiatric Physician with High-Complexity Experience: MD, DO, or DPM, appropriately licensed, and at least two years of experience directing or supervising high-complexity testing, plus the applicable laboratory-director continuing education requirement. Option 3 – Doctoral-Level Laboratory Scientist: An earned doctoral degree in chemical, biological, clinical or medical laboratory science, or medical technology from an accredited institution; OR another earned doctorate with either:At least 16 semester hours of doctoral-level coursework in biology, chemistry, medical technology, clinical laboratory science, or medical laboratory science OR An approved thesis/research project in one of those areas related to human laboratory testing; AND current certification by an HHS-approved board, and at least two years of laboratory training/experience and two years of experience directing or supervising high-complexity testing, plus the applicable laboratory-director continuing education requirement. Option 4 – Grandfathered CLIA Laboratory Director: An individual who was qualified and serving as a Laboratory Director of high‑complexity testing in a CLIA‑certified laboratory as of December 28, 2024, and has continuously served in that capacity since that date.
